Course Description:
'' Information is a key to the success of any organization. Gathering and sharing information within your organization, with clients and customers alike, can also be an important task. Microsoft�Office InfoPath�2007: Creating InfoPath Forms is a product that gathers and shares information. In this course, you will use InfoPath to streamline the process of gathering and sharing information.
Audience
Persons with web design experience, forms administrators, information coordinators, Microsoft Office system power users who need to gather, reuse, distribute, and collaborate using XML-based forms.
At Course Completion
Upon successful completion of this course, students will be able to:
create InfoPath forms.
import and export form data.
customize form layout.
manage views.
secure the forms.
distribute forms.
manage controls.
work with databases. Prerequisites
Students taking this class should have proficiency in Microsoft Office products, concentrating in forms development and experience working in a tagged environment (such as, HTML or FrameMaker with SGML).
Course Objective
You will learn how to use InfoPath to gather and share information by creating and implementing XML-based forms.
